Federal effort underway to block telemarketers

June 27, 2003 By admin

Iowa’s top prosecutor is backing the new federal effort to block telemarketing calls. The Federal Trade Commission today launched a toll-free number and a website where people can register their phone numbers, which Iowa Attorney General Tom Miller says will be a big plus for anyone who has a phone.Federal officials say the hotelier and the website “www.donotcall.gov” was getting 108 people registered every second nationwide earlier today. Miller expects it to be highly popular with Iowans, though he says registering -won’t- eliminate all telemarketing calls.Miller says it won’t guarantee -all- calls will stop, but it should end a “vast majority” of them. Exceptions include: political calls, charities, telephone surveys and insurance companies. Hundreds of Iowans work in telemarketing call centers in Cedar Rapids, Davenport and Des Moines. Miller says he does -not- see this new “do not call” service hurting the direct-marketing industry in Iowa.Iowans can call 888-382-1222 from the phone they’d like to have registered on the “do not call” list. And again, registration can also be performed online at “www.donotcall.gov”.
